   I have been a Wood Doctor dealer in central Pennsylvania for the past eight years. I have sold over 400 of the Wood Doctor furnaces over those years and have considered the units quality made. From what I know, the problems started when partners Dave McCulloch and Arthur Turple parted ways about a year ago. That is about the time Rick Fulcher, a man with Wall Street experience (and a record) got involved from Virginia. I had always questioned Dave’s sales tactics which amounted to telling customers anything he felt they wanted to hear to make a sale. Dave’s cell was 406-750-1633 and had a usadavid@hotmail.com email address. Arthur was more honest in his approach.
   In February 2011, I was told by Arthur and Rick that they were getting a $25 million government grant to open Creative Energy Solutions in Farmville, VA and start production there. They apologized for their lack of support to their dealers and stated how things are going to change in the future as they took my wife and I to dinner (We even had prayer before eating). Dealer training would be implemented and a larger line of products would be available soon. After delays from January 2011 thru July 2011 (the date production was to start) things began to unravel. Costs were too high and another company, Triton Metals, of Hollywood, MD was contacted about production, but the costs were higher than expected. In the meantime, Silverwind Metals in Manitoba Canada was not asked to sign a contract for 2011 with Arthur, so now Wood Doctor had no furnaces to sell. He told me that “after a night of prayer, he wrote a letter to Silverwinds and they agreed to produce more furnaces to help him out one last time.”
   I had ordered a load of furnaces on July 29, 2011 and paid for them by wire as I had done the previous 7 years, but the furnaces did not arrive till late September after many phone calls. I had those sold by the time they arrived, so I asked Arthur to send me another load and I would pay when they were ready to ship. I sent a wire directly to Silverwinds in October and received another load of stoves.
   Then the problems started for me. I told Arthur that if he needed any partial load  stove orders to complete any loads to the eastern US, I would purchase whatever it took to complete the load. He said he had room for 2 units, so in November I wired money to the account at Creative Energy Solutions in Farmville, VA as he suggested in the amount of $16380. I was to be getting replacement parts for Rich Coons’ furnace in the same load. We have been waiting for six weeks for the shipment when I last spoke with Rich at the PA Farm Show. He had mentioned at the time of the order that I could have sent the money directly to Silverwinds, so I was not suspicious of any major financial problems at the time.

    Silverwind Metals does have an online store on their new website (www.polarfurnaces.com) that offers ALL parts for any Wood Doctor furnaces at prices that are less expensive than the same item being purchased through Wood Doctor. They also manufacture the Polar Outdoor Furnace which is a clone of the Wood Doctor furnace that had been manufactured successfully for many years. For those seeking parts or warranty help, I would suggest getting in contact with Silverwind Metals because they are the manufacturer that made Wood Doctor units and ultimately should be backing the warranty in some manner.
